Originally Posted by 98_WS6_T/A
Ok I just read all 5 pages of this thread, and one question has been asked many times but not answered.....

When you have the AIR and EGR codes "tuned out" does it cause those monitors to show up as "not ready"??? I live in Mass and need to pass the diagnostic test, and I believe I can only have two monitors not ready.
I would like to know the answer to this question as well. I do know 96'-00' cars 2 monitors not ready is ok and 01'-present cars 1 monitor not ready is it. FYI I am an inspector at a central mass shop and I am F-Body friendly
